The most notable upgrade in the Ice Barrel 500 is its fully insulated construction. Unlike previous models, this version features thick polyurethane foam insulation throughout the barrel and lid.

This dramatically improves the tub’s ability to maintain cold temperatures, even in warm ambient conditions.

During testing, I was impressed to find the water temperature remained stable at 50°F for four days without adding ice or running a chiller, despite outdoor temperatures in the 70s. This insulation performance is very important for consistent cold therapy sessions and reduced maintenance.

Getting in and out of the Ice Barrel 500 is remarkably easy thanks to the integrated steps on both the exterior and interior. This design element enhances safety and accessibility, making cold plunges more approachable for users of varying fitness levels and mobility.

The textured interior seat provides a comfortable resting spot during immersion, though its fixed position may limit flexibility for some users.

The Ice Barrel 500’s spacious upright design comfortably accommodates most body types up to 69 inches tall. With a 94-gallon capacity, there’s enough room for full-body immersion up to the neck for most users.

However, taller individuals may find submerging their head challenging because of the barrel’s depth and interior seat configuration.

Durability is a strong point for the Ice Barrel 500. Constructed from high-quality, recycled LLDPE plastic, the barrel feels robust and built to last.

The UV-resistant cover and lid protect the tub and water from sun exposure and debris, extending the time between water changes.

Ice Barrel backs their product with a limited lifetime warranty, showcasing confidence in its longevity.

One of the most practical upgrades is the inclusion of chiller ports, allowing easy connection to Ice Barrel’s proprietary chiller or third-party cooling systems. This feature provides users the option to maintain precise water temperatures without relying solely on ice, especially beneficial in warmer climates or for those desiring consistent cold therapy year-round.

Maintenance of the Ice Barrel 500 is straightforward, with an easy-flow drainage system facilitating water changes. The company recommends changing the water every 4 weeks, though this may vary based on usage and environmental factors.

A maintenance kit is available separately, containing essential items for keeping the barrel and water clean.

While the Ice Barrel 500 offers numerous improvements, there are a few considerations to keep in mind. The larger footprint (12.5 square feet) may pose challenges for users with limited space.

The fixed interior seat, while comfortable, restricts movement and facing options within the barrel.

Ice Barrel 500 gubbins

Some users may find the depth not enough for easy head submersion, requiring some maneuvering.

Advanced Usage Techniques

Progressive Adaptation Protocol

Based on military cold-weather training principles:

Week 1-2:

Temperature: 55°F
Duration: 2-3 minutes
Frequency: Every other day

Week 3-4:

Temperature: 50°F
Duration: 3-5 minutes
Frequency: Daily

Week 5+:

Temperature: 45°F
Duration: 5-10 minutes
Frequency: Daily or twice daily
